Your neighborhood is either too cool, or not cool enough, for bikeshare kiosks:

The city’s new bike share program is set to offer thousands of wheels at 600 kiosks across Brooklyn and Manhattan beginning this summer — but the proposed plan leaves a significant chunk of Greenpoint without stations, according to a Department of Transportation draft.

Locals say there is a significant need for the program in the neighborhood, but the DOT’s recent map has not proposed bike kiosks east of [McGuinness] Boulevard, including McGolrick Park and other residential areas of Greenpoint.

Baby as coffeehouse accessory:

Brooklyn’s obsessive coffee culture is rubbing off on the borough’s youngest cafe-goers, with tots ditching their bottles and juice boxes in favor of “babyccinos” — mini decaf cappuccinos or frothy cups of steamed milk and foam.

Moms and dads in neighborhoods like Park Slope, Fort Greene and Prospect Heights are ordering the small, foamy, surprisingly grown-up beverages for their pint-sized offspring.

Ambulance Camouflage

That’s how you beat a ticket:

A mystery emergency vehicle, fitted with ambulance flashers and official markings, has hogged up space at an expired meter on Avenue N in Marine Park for more than a week, but has not been towed, area merchants claim — even though the “ambulance” is stuffed with construction material.
